SINGAPORE, March 11, 2025 – KIP Protocol has unveiled an exciting development in the world of artificial intelligence with the launch of Superior AI Agents. This innovative framework represents the first step towards truly autonomous, self-learning AI systems.

Superior AI Agents differ from traditional models by continuously evolving. Unlike conventional AI, which relies on static data and human input, these agents learn and adapt to real-world situations on their own. Their ability to independently discover knowledge marks a significant leap in the pursuit of Artificial Superintelligence (ASI).

The researchers at KIP Protocol emphasize that to achieve ASI, AI must be self-learning. By removing the limitations of human-designed benchmarks, Superior AI Agents can redefine various industries. They have already achieved a major milestone, becoming the first autonomous AI capable of covering their own operational costs through online trading, utilizing their advanced learning techniques to refine their strategies based on past experiences.

The potential applications of Superior AI Agents are vast, including:

– AI-Powered Financial Trading: Developing optimal trading strategies independently.
– Self-Evolving Cybersecurity: Conducting penetration tests to uncover vulnerabilities.
– Autonomous Gaming: Adjusting game difficulty based on player performance.
– Optimized Manufacturing: Enhancing production efficiency through real-time learning.
– AI-Generated Content: Adapting creative outputs based on audience interactions.

Dr. Jennifer Dodgson, Founder and Chief Researcher of Superior Agents, expressed her excitement: “This week, we took a giant leap closer to truly autonomous, life-like AI.” She believes that these advancements will change how AI interacts with its environment and evolves.

KIP Protocol aims to provide cutting-edge Web3 infrastructure that empowers AI developers and fosters a decentralized AI economy, ensuring that creators can develop, monetize, and own their AI assets.
